Commercial Asphalt Sealing in Greenville, SC

Commercial asphalt sealing services involve applying a protective coating to asphalt surfaces such as parking lots, driveways, and pathways. This process helps to extend the lifespan of the asphalt by preventing damage from water, UV rays, and daily wear and tear. Property owners typically request this service to maintain the appearance of their commercial or residential parking areas, reduce the need for repairs, and improve safety by providing a smooth, even surface. Projects can vary from sealing small private driveways to large commercial parking lots, making it a versatile solution for many property types.

Before requesting asphalt sealing, property owners should consider the current condition of their asphalt surface, including any existing cracks or damage that may need repair beforehand. It’s also helpful to understand the importance of proper surface preparation, such as cleaning and crack filling, to ensure the best results. Sealing is generally most effective when applied to clean, dry asphalt that is free of debris, and timing can impact the longevity of the sealant. Knowing these factors can help property owners make informed decisions about the right maintenance for their asphalt surfaces.

Project Types

Common Commercial Asphalt Sealing Jobs

Parking lot sealing - helps protect asphalt surfaces in commercial parking areas from weather and wear.

Driveway sealing - enhances the durability and appearance of residential driveways.

Loading dock sealing - maintains a safe and protected surface for commercial loading zones.

Business lot sealing - extends the lifespan of paved business parking lots and reduces maintenance needs.

Sidewalk sealing - prevents cracks and surface deterioration on commercial walkways.

Industrial pavement sealing - safeguards heavy-duty asphalt surfaces used in industrial facilities.

FAQ

Commercial Asphalt Sealing Questions

What is asphalt sealing? Asphalt sealing involves applying a protective coating to extend the lifespan of parking lots and driveways by preventing damage from water, UV rays, and chemicals.

When should asphalt sealing be done? Sealing is typically recommended every 2 to 3 years to maintain surface protection and appearance.

What types of projects benefit from asphalt sealing? Driveways, parking lots, and private roads are common projects that benefit from sealing to improve durability and curb appeal.

What should property owners know before sealing asphalt? The surface should be clean and dry before application to ensure proper adhesion and effectiveness of the sealant.
